本地部署AI代理Rick AI CEO:开源自主智能体系统架构与实战指南
1. 项目概述一个真正能“安装”的AI CEO如果你和我一样是个独立开发者、小团队创始人或者任何需要同时扮演产品、销售、客服、市场、财务多重角色的“光杆司令”那你肯定对“时间不够用”和“精力被琐事榨干”这两件事深有体会。我们总在幻想要是有个不知疲倦、能力超群的“数字分身”能帮我处理那些重复、琐碎但又至关重要的事务就好了——比如盯着收入变化、回复潜在客户邮件、整理销售线索甚至在我睡觉时还能推进一些创意工作。市面上大多数所谓的“AI助手”要么是简单的聊天机器人要么是功能单一的自动化工具离一个真正的“数字合伙人”还差得很远。直到我遇到了Rick AI CEO。这玩意儿彻底颠覆了我对AI代理的认知。它不是一个SaaS服务而是一个你可以直接安装在本地机器macOS或Linux上的自主运行代理。想象一下你雇佣了一位全年无休、成本极低免费版完全免费专业版每月9美元的“首席运营官”。它有自己的心跳每30分钟自动运行一次有自己的长期记忆系统能根据你的业务需求调用最合适的大模型Claude Opus, GPT-5.4, Gemini 3.1, Grok 4并通过Telegram、Slack等渠道与你交互每天早上还会给你发送一份包含优先级、管道状态和夜间行动的简报。最吸引我的是它的理念Own your PL。你的数据、你的记忆、你的业务逻辑都运行在你的机器上通过一个名为OpenClaw的运行时环境管理。它不是一个黑盒服务而是一个你可以理解、甚至参与贡献的开源项目MIT协议。在试用并深度使用了几周后我决定把从安装、配置到实战应用的全过程以及我踩过的坑和总结的经验完整地分享出来。无论你是想找一个免费的效率倍增器还是需要一个能处理复杂业务逻辑的付费伙伴这篇文章都能给你一个清晰的路线图。2. 核心架构与设计哲学拆解在深入实操之前我们必须先理解Rick AI CEO的底层逻辑。它之所以强大不是因为用了某个单一的最强模型而是因为它构建了一套完整的自主智能体系统架构。这和我们平时用的ChatGPT API调用有本质区别。2.1 核心组件不止是“大脑”更是“神经系统”Rick的核心运行在~/.openclaw/目录下这个结构设计得非常清晰反映了一个完整智能体的构成~/.openclaw/ ├── workspace/ │ ├── SOUL.md # 人格与操作原则 │ ├── HEARTBEAT.md # 30分钟操作周期日志 │ ├── MEMORY.md # 长期记忆索引 │ ├── MEMORY-WARM.md # 活跃上下文最近30天 │ ├── IDENTITY.md # Rick #N – 你的Rick的唯一身份 │ ├── USER.md # 你的偏好Rick会随时间学习 │ ├── config/ # 各种策略配置文件 │ └── skills/ # 技能库目录SOUL.md 与 IDENTITY.md这是Rick的“人格内核”。SOUL.md定义了它的核心操作原则、道德边界和响应风格。IDENTITY.md则是在你安装时生成的唯一标识如 Rick #42。这确保了你的Rick是独一无二的它的决策会基于它与你互动的历史而形成独特的风格。实操心得不要忽略编辑SOUL.md你可以在这里加入你希望Rick遵循的特定工作原则比如“所有对外沟通必须保持专业且简洁”、“在涉及财务决策时必须提供至少两个备选方案并分析利弊”。记忆系统MEMORY.md, MEMORY-WARM.md这是Rick区别于普通聊天机器人的关键。它采用了一种类似人类记忆的“衰减”模型热记忆7天最近高频访问的信息响应速度最快。温记忆8-30天近期但非即时的信息需要时可快速调取。冷记忆30天归档信息不会主动参与日常推理但可通过特定查询唤醒。 这个设计巧妙地解决了大模型上下文窗口有限和“遗忘”问题。Rick会自动从对话、任务结果中提取“事实”Fact并分类存储。注意事项记忆的提取和归类依赖Rick的内置技能对于非结构化的复杂信息有时需要你通过对话明确指示“请将这一点记录到长期记忆中”。技能库skills/Rick的能力不是单一的而是由24个商业版模块化技能组成。每个技能都是一个独立的、针对特定任务的微工作流。例如email-triage/: 邮件分类与优先级排序。revenue-tracker/: 连接你的支付网关如StripeAPI监控收入事件。coding-agent-loops/: 执行简单的编码、代码审查或调试循环。strategy-panel/: 商业版功能协调多个大模型进行共识性战略分析。核心优势在于这些技能可以被“心跳”周期性地自动触发也可以由你通过聊天指令即时调用。2.2 多模型路由与“大脑”集群Rick不绑定任何一个AI供应商。它内置了一个智能模型路由Model Router。这个路由会根据任务类型、复杂度、成本预算自动选择最合适的“大脑”Claude Opus (Anthropic)被用作“战略”大脑。当任务涉及复杂推理、长文档分析、需要深思熟虑的战略规划时Rick会优先路由至此。GPT-5.4 (OpenAI)被用作“创意”大脑。擅长内容生成、头脑风暴、营销文案等需要创造力的任务。Gemini 3.1 (Google)被用作“事实”大脑。在处理需要高准确性、数据查询、事实核查的任务时表现更佳。Grok 4 (xAI)被用作“逆向”大脑。负责提供 contrarian 观点挑战现有假设避免群体思维在策略评估时尤其有用。背后的逻辑没有哪个模型在所有领域都完美。通过路由策略Rick能以更低的综合成本获得更优、更可靠的结果。例如处理一份财报分析战略事实可能由Opus主导Gemini辅助核查数据而生成一篇产品发布推特则可能交给GPT-5.4。2.3 心跳机制自主运行的引擎“Heartbeat”是Rick自主性的核心。它不是一个常驻内存的守护进程而是一个由系统定时任务如cron触发的脚本默认每30分钟执行一次。每次心跳会顺序执行以下检查检查消息渠道轮询Telegram、Slack专业版以上、邮箱商业版等获取新指令或信息。处理待办任务执行任务队列中已批准或低风险级别的任务如发送跟进邮件、更新CRM记录。扫描业务管道通过API检查连接的服务如Stripe, HubSpot是否有状态更新如新付款、新销售线索。记忆维护运行记忆衰减算法将旧记忆从“热”降级为“温”或“冷”并提取新事实。这种“拉取式”而非“常驻式”的设计极大降低了资源占用也使得Rick可以在任何支持cron的服务器甚至低功耗设备上运行。2.4 Rick网络匿名的集体智能这是Rick另一个精妙的设计。每个安装的Rick在用户同意下会匿名地向中央网络api.meetrick.ai发送聚合数据如技能使用频率、错误类型、任务完成量。绝对不发送任何私人数据或业务内容。你得到什么技能流行度排行知道其他Rick最常用哪些技能帮你发现新用法。错误趋势预警如果某个技能突然在很多节点上失败网络会提前预警团队会快速修复。同行基准测试在Pro和Business tier你可以看到类似规模的Rick平均处理多少任务、常用哪些模型组合从而优化自己的配置。实时地图在meetrick.ai/map上可以看到全球活跃的Rick仅显示数量和大致区域非常酷。你可以通过--no-telemetry参数或创建~/.openclaw/.no_telemetry文件完全退出网络。3. 从零开始安装、配置与初体验理论讲完了我们动手把它装起来。整个过程比想象中简单但有些细节决定成败。3.1 系统准备与环境检查Rick需要 macOS 或 Linux 环境并确保已安装Python 3.8和pip。Node.js 22.x。这是必须的因为部分技能和OpenClaw运行时依赖Node环境。curl和bash这通常是系统自带的。安装前检查# 检查Python python3 --version # 检查Node.js node --version # 检查curl curl --version如果缺少Node.js强烈建议使用nvm来安装和管理避免权限问题。# 使用nvm安装Node.js 22 cur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.39.0/install.sh | bash # 重新打开终端或运行 source ~/.bashrc (或 ~/.zshrc) nvm install 22 nvm use 223.2 一键安装与初始化官方提供的一键安装脚本非常可靠curl -fsSL https://meetrick.ai/install.sh | bash执行后脚本会检查系统依赖。下载并安装OpenClaw运行时一个轻量级容器化环境用于隔离Rick的技能和依赖。下载对应版本的Rick核心包Free, Pro, Business。在~/.openclaw/下初始化工作空间。引导你进行初始配置。关键步骤Telegram机器人连接安装脚本最后会打印一个链接引导你创建一个Telegram Bot。这是与Rick交互的主要界面。在Telegram中搜索BotFather发送/newbot并按提示操作获得一个Bot Token。然后你需要找到你的Telegram User ID可以通过给userinfobot发送消息获得。将这两项信息提供给安装脚本或后续的配置流程。重要提示妥善保存你的Bot Token它相当于Rick在Telegram上的密码。同时建议立即在BotFather中为你创建的机器人设置一个隐私模式/setprivacy为Disable这样Rick才能看到群组中的所有消息如果你打算在群组中使用它。3.3 首次启动与日常简报安装配置完成后运行rick start启动服务。你会看到Rick在终端启动并注册到网络例如成为 Rick #42。接下来去Telegram找到你的机器人发送/start或简单说个“嗨”。Rick会回应你并开始它的第一次心跳周期。体验核心功能每日简报如果你是Pro或Business用户Rick会在你设定的时间默认是当地早上8点通过Telegram发送一份每日简报。这份简报通常包含昨日回顾完成了哪些任务收入有无变化管道状态更新。今日优先级基于待办事项和记忆建议你关注的重点。待审批项目需要你点头才能继续的自动化任务根据你的approval-policy.json设置。网络洞察Pro从Rick网络获取的与你业务相关的匿名趋势提示。我的第一份简报让我印象深刻它准确总结了我前一天通过邮件沟通的一个潜在客户的状态并提醒我“如果今天下午前未收到回复建议发送一条简短的跟进信息”。这证明它的记忆和管道监控技能已经开始工作了。3.4 三大版本选择与升级策略功能维度Free (免费)Pro ($9/月)Business ($499/月)核心价值体验核心自动化有限技能个人或小团队全能助手小型企业自动化中枢技能数量5个16个24个主要模型Claude HaikuClaude SonnetClaude Opus备用模型1个3个5个通信渠道Telegram Slack Email Webhooks简报频率无每日 每周 夜间 月度战略子代理无无5个并发(Iris, Remy, Teagan)夜间自主性无无分级信任 (L1→L3)战略面板无无多模型共识每日LLM预算$2$45$470选择建议从Free开始没有任何成本可以完整体验Rick的心跳、基础记忆和5个核心技能如邮件分类、简单任务执行。足够你判断它是否适合你的工作流。升级到Pro的时机当你发现Free版的技能不够用比如需要连接Slack、需要每日简报来规划工作、需要更多模型选择来处理复杂任务并且Rick已经为你节省了远超$9/月的时间价值时。$9/月的价格对于独立开发者来说几乎无感但带来的效率提升是显著的。考虑Business的场景你有一个小团队需要Rick同时处理市场研究Iris、数据分析Remy、内容分发Teagan等多个并行任务或者你的业务涉及复杂的、多步骤的自动化流程需要“战略面板”协调多个AI模型进行深度分析亦或是你需要Rick在夜间拥有更高的自主权如自动发送报告、处理客户咨询。升级路径无缝所有配置、记忆和身份都会保留。只需在官网用新的许可证密钥重新运行安装脚本即可。4. 实战进阶技能配置、管道连接与自动化编排安装只是开始让Rick真正融入你的业务流才能发挥最大价值。4.1 配置核心技能以收入追踪和CRM为例Rick的技能需要通过配置文件或对话来激活和连接你的外部服务。连接 Stripe (收入追踪)在Stripe仪表板生成一个只读的API密钥。通过Telegram向Rick发送指令/config set stripe_api_key sk_live_xxxRick会确认配置并在下一次心跳时开始监控charge.succeeded,invoice.paid,customer.subscription.updated等事件。你可以在~/.openclaw/workspace/config/health.json中调整收入检查的频率和告警阈值。连接 HubSpot CRM (或类似工具)同样获取API密钥。发送指令/config set hubspot_api_key xxxxxRick可以帮你将新捕获的销售线索自动创建为联系人根据邮件交互更新联系人的状态定期同步交易管道阶段。配置实操心得最小权限原则始终使用只读或权限范围尽可能小的API密钥。分步验证配置后让Rick执行一个简单任务来测试连接如“Rick检查一下我们上周的收入情况”。利用USER.md在这个文件里你可以用自然语言描述你的业务背景、你的角色、你希望Rick如何称呼你、你的工作习惯等。Rick会学习并适应。例如我在里面写了“我是一名SaaS独立开发者主要客户来自北美和欧洲习惯在UTC时间上午处理邮件。请在所有分析中优先考虑单位月度经常性收入MRR和客户终身价值LTV。” 这使它的回复更具针对性。4.2 设计自动化工作流从简单到复杂Rick的威力在于将多个技能串联起来形成自动化工作流。案例一潜在客户跟进自动化触发Rick监控指定邮箱发现一封来自新潜在客户的咨询邮件email-triage技能识别。行动Rick自动解析邮件内容提取公司、姓名、需求等关键信息fact-extraction技能。记录在CRM中创建一条新的联系人记录并打上“新咨询”标签。响应根据你预设的模板可在USER.md中定义风格草拟一封个性化的回复邮件并发送给你审批根据approval-policy.json设置可配置为直接发送或需审核。跟进如果在48小时内未收到回复Rick会在每日简报中提醒你或自动发送一封温和的跟进邮件需L2以上自主性。案例二内容发布与推广循环指令你告诉Rick“基于我们产品的最新功能X写一篇博客草稿并规划推特发布。”执行Rick调用coding-agent-loops或内容创作技能使用GPT-5.4生成博客草稿。同时调用strategy-panel商业版让Opus、Gemini和Grok分别评估草稿的深度、准确性和话题性生成综合修改建议。根据建议修改后将草稿发给你终审。你批准后Rick可以调用Webhook技能将博客发布到你的CMS如Ghost, WordPress。发布后自动生成3-5条推广推特并通过social-distribution技能商业版在指定时间间隔发布。4.3 调整自主性级别在控制与放手之间找到平衡对于Business用户overnight-autonomy夜间自主性是一个强大但需要谨慎配置的功能。它在~/.openclaw/workspace/config/approval-policy.json中定义{ level_1: { description: 仅监控与报告, actions: [monitor_revenue, check_emails, update_crm_status], requires_approval: false }, level_2: { description: 起草与建议, actions: [draft_email_response, draft_social_post, suggest_follow_up], requires_approval: true // 草稿需你确认 }, level_3: { description: 有限执行, actions: [send_follow_up_email_auto, post_to_social_media_scheduled], requires_approval: false, // 对完全信任的任务可自动执行 conditions: [is_weekday, time_between_09_17_utc] // 增加执行条件 } }我的建议从Level 1开始运行一两周观察Rick的报告是否准确。然后逐步开放Level 2的权限让它起草内容由你最终拍板。对于Level 3只对那些定义清晰、规则明确、出错成本低的任务如每天上午10点发布一条预定推特开启自动执行。永远为关键业务操作如处理退款、发送合同保留人工审批。5. 故障排除、维护与性能优化即使设计再精良在实际运行中也可能遇到问题。以下是我总结的常见问题与解决方案。5.1 基础状态检查与日志当Rick行为异常或没有响应时首先使用CLI工具检查rick status # 检查Rick服务是否在运行 rick logs # 查看最近的活动日志关注ERROR或WARNING rick restart # 重启服务解决大部分临时性问题日志分析要点API密钥错误通常在连接外部服务Stripe, Slack时出现。检查密钥是否过期或权限不足。心跳失败检查系统定时任务cron是否正常。可以手动运行rick heartbeat测试。内存不足Rick的OpenClaw运行时默认会限制资源。如果运行复杂任务可以适当调整~/.openclaw/workspace/config/health.json中的资源分配。5.2 网络连接与更新问题Rick需要访问外部APIOpenAI, Anthropic等和更新服务器。连接超时如果你在某些网络环境下遇到问题可以检查Rick的代理配置如果有的话。配置文件通常在~/.openclaw/runtime/config/network.json。更新失败自动更新每周进行一次。如果失败可以手动触发bash ~/.openclaw/.rick_update.sh --force或者使用修复脚本不会影响你的数据和配置curl -fsSL https://meetrick.ai/repair.sh | bash5.3 数据备份与迁移你的核心数据记忆、人格、配置是安全的但主动备份总是好习惯。# 备份整个工作空间核心数据所在 cp -r ~/.openclaw/workspace ~/backups/rick-workspace-$(date %Y%m%d) # 如果你需要迁移到新机器 # 1. 在新机器上安装Rick同一版本。 # 2. 停止新旧机器上的Rick服务 (rick stop)。 # 3. 将旧机器的 ~/.openclaw/workspace 目录整体复制到新机器的对应位置。 # 4. 复制 ~/.openclaw/.rick_id 和 ~/.openclaw/.rick_secret确保权限为600。 # 5. 在新机器上启动Rick (rick start)。重要警告不要尝试手动修改~/.openclaw/下由运行时管理的文件这可能导致不可预知的行为。5.4 性能调优建议控制LLM预算在~/.openclaw/workspace/config/token-budgets.json中为每个模型路由设置每日预算上限防止意外费用。Free版有$2的硬限制Pro和Business版可以根据需要调整。优化记忆衰减如果你发现Rick响应变慢可能是热记忆积累过多。可以调整记忆衰减策略让更早的信息更快地转入冷记忆。这需要在SOUL.md或高级配置中定义。技能按需加载Rick不会同时激活所有技能。它根据你的使用频率和lane-policy.json的配置来动态加载。如果你只用其中几个技能性能完全不是问题。6. 安全、隐私与伦理考量将AI深度集成到业务中必须考虑安全隐私。数据本地化Rick最大的优势是核心数据和业务逻辑运行在你的机器上。你的邮件内容、客户数据、财务信息不会发送到Rick的服务器。只有你明确要求调用外部AI API时相关的、最小化的上下文才会被发送给相应的供应商OpenAI, Anthropic等。API密钥管理Rick将你的API密钥加密存储在本地~/.openclaw/.rick_secret。确保该文件权限为600仅所有者可读写。不要将其分享或上传到任何地方。网络遥测如前所述Rick网络只收集完全匿名的聚合指标。你可以随时选择退出且这不会影响核心功能。自动化边界必须通过approval-policy.json清晰定义Rick的权限边界。特别是涉及金钱交易、法律承诺或敏感客户沟通时务必设置为“需要人工批准”。永远不要赋予一个AI完全的、无监督的财务或法律决策权。使用Rick这类工具最终的监督责任和决策权仍然在你。它是一位不知疲倦的副驾驶但方向盘和刹车必须牢牢掌握在你手中。我的体会是它最擅长的不是替代你思考而是把你从信息过载和重复劳动中解放出来让你能更专注于只有人类才能做好的事情——战略、创造和与真实的人建立连接。